Output 31ff7b15a962fff6fea2eebb9eea0078899093e3c2a2aaa34a6bd858759628d5:3

value
116226900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de19ca94a6472fffeee5171d5ef7a76f0232edc OP_EQUAL
address
3DAcfKJ2x5HPDnwQc6WGaAyVd2GdDYka7Z
transaction
31ff7b15a962fff6fea2eebb9eea0078899093e3c2a2aaa34a6bd858759628d5
spent
true